Digital genomes help interpret the genomic datasets and convert them into clinically interpretable information for improved healthcare outcomes. With advancement in next generation sequencing technologies, there is huge amount of genomic data being generated which require computational approaches for analysis. Digital genome products help analyze and interpret this genomic data through integration of AI and machine learning capabilities.

Market key trends:

One of the key trends contributing to the growth of digital genome market is increasing integration of artificial intelligence. Genome analysis involves complex computational analysis of huge amount of genomic data. Integration of AI capabilities helps improve the accuracy and speed of genome data analysis. AI algorithms can be trained on huge genomic datasets to identify patterns and insights. This helps in automating routine analysis tasks as well as facilitating novel discoveries. Various market players are focusing on development of AI-powered digital genomic platforms and solutions to handle extensive genomic data workflows and provide clinically actionable insights.
